Normally the two middle toenails of a dog’s foot are close together. If you notice them spreading apart, this is a sign of swelling. Dog boots, rubber bands, and rope/string can all cut off the circulation in a dog’s paw. If possible, keep your dog’s toes exposed. This will allow you to check for swelling that would indicate that the circulation of your dog’s paw is being cut off.
